Tokamaks and turbulence: research ensembles, policy and technoscientific work
Article Abstract:
A look at how the research technologies used by a group connects them to other researchers and policymakers and how in turn it influences the working of the group.

Does science push technology? Patents citing scientific literature
Article Abstract:
The role of scientific research and science policy in the development of technology is examined in detail, using evidence from patents citing scientific research.
